Overview of the French Driving License
In France, the driving license system is classified into different license classes, mostly divided into 2 main types:
Permis B: This is the most common driving license, allowing the holder to drive cars and light lorries.
Permis A: This license is required for motorcycles, with subcategories for different engine sizes.
The French driving license is necessary not only for legal driving on French roadways but likewise acts as a crucial form of identification.

Actions to Obtain a French Driving License Online
Obtaining a French driving license online involves numerous uncomplicated steps, which are as follows:
1. Register on the ANTS Platform
The French National Agency for Secure Documents (ANTS) manages the application procedure for driving licenses. To start:
Visit the ANTS website.Develop an account by supplying required personal information (name, address, date of birth, and so on).2. Prepare Documentation
Applicants will need to gather and publish the following files:
Proof of Identity: Such as a legitimate passport or national ID card.Evidence of Residence: An energy costs, bank declaration, or any official file that reveals your address in France.Medical Certificate: If needed, it must verify your medical fitness to drive.3. Complete the Online Application Form
When registered, the applicant can fill out the online application form with the following details:
Personal information (given name, surname, date of birth).Kind of driving license being requested.Declaration of previous licenses held (if any).4. Upload Documents
Scan and publish the needed files through the ANTS platform. Guarantee that all files are readable and abide by document specifications offered on the site.
5. Pay the Fee
A fee is normally associated with making an application for a driving license, which varies depending upon the category. Payment can be completed online through protected payment methods.
6. Set up and Complete the Theory and Practical Tests
Upon successful submission, prospects will get further directions on scheduling their theory (code de la path) and useful driving tests. These can frequently be booked through designated driving schools or by means of the ANTS website.
7. Receive Confirmation and License Issuance
After passing both tests, the prospect will receive a momentary driving license via email, followed by a physical license sent by post.

2. What if I already have a driving license from another nation?
If you hold a driving license from another EU country, you might transform it to a French license without taking the tests. For licenses from non-EU nations, various rules apply, and you might require to take the tests.
3. How long is the French driving license valid?
Normally, the French driving license is valid for 15 years. After this period, it needs to be renewed.
